Step-by-step explanation:
Length of the skid marks = 242 feet
The formula used for the velocity is
[tex]v=2\sqrt{5L}[/tex]
where, L is the length of skid marks in feet and the velocity obtain has the units of miles per hour.
By substituting the value
[tex]v=2\sqrt{5\times 242}[/tex]
v = 69.6 miles per hour
Thus, the speed of the car at the time of accident is 69.6 miles per hour.
